Skip to product information
1 of 1

Omorovicza Silver Skin Saviour 50ml

Omorovicza Silver Skin Saviour 50ml

Regular price 187.00 SAR
Regular price Sale price 187.00 SAR
Sale Sold out

Omorovicza Silver Skin Saviour 50ml

View full details